Many moons ago, roleplaying games were begotten from strategy based miniature battles. With this background in war games, and the propensity of massive battles in many of the tropes of fantasy and sci-fi, it is not surprising when you look at a lot of older RPGs and see systems for massive battles.

Then a funny thing happened, games started going away from the complicated strategy based mass combat systems and toward abstract rules for battles.
